January Garden update

January is probably the least interesting month of the year for gardening but it seemed like it was time for an update. I planted some primrose today because it's the only colorful thing available right now. I also put a few more ornamental cabbages in a couple of weeks ago, again...just needed a blast of color. And that is the reason for the yellow pot with rosemary in it. I want to add more permanent visually pleasing things and that seemed like a good start. I am getting desperate for things to do in the garden so i trimmed the lavender and did some general clean up of dead stuff last week. Still need to prune the fruit trees. The fava beans are doing well as is the garlic. It will be interesting to see if the favas get as big as last year. So far they are relatively small bushes but that could change if we ever get some sun. Corvallis has been under a blanket of freezing fog for the last week.
